Lawrence LeMay Obituary

He is preceded in death by wife Gloria. He is survived by children Anne & David; 4 grandchildren; sister Barbara. Mass of Christian Burial Thursday, January 17, 2013 at 2pm in the Archdiocese of Denver Mortuary Chapel. Burial Mt. Olivet Cemetery.
